TEKsystems is looking for a *Process Consultant* to support one of our top clients in a remote capacity. This role offers exposure to large-scale SaaS implementations, collaboration across teams, and the opportunity to work on a high-impact Workday project. The client values strong process design experience, stakeholder engagement, and business process mapping.
*Top Skills:* * Experience with Workday or similar SaaS vendor implementations * Strong process management and documentation skills * Proficient in process diagramming using Blueworks Live and VISIO * Familiarity with ERP systems and business process methodologies * Ability to gather and interpret stakeholder input across functional areas *Job Description:* This Process Consultant will be embedded within cross-functional teams, conducting interviews, creating business process maps, and contributing to process design efforts. Responsibilities include documenting processes, identifying requirements for new or existing workflows, and supporting adoption of technology improvements through prototyping, pilots, and customer scenarios. The consultant will work in an *Agile environment*, owning end-to-end process designs and collaborating across the organization to meet business goals.
